I really need help understanding when/ what situations to use sine rule and cosine rule with triangles, plssss.

If you want a missing angle or side in one pair, and you have at least one side and angle pair, use the sine rule.

If you want a remaining side, and you have the other two sides and the angle opposite the unknown side, use the cosine rule.

If you want an angle, and you have all three sides, use the cosine rule rearranged for angles.

Find a formula for the general term an of the sequence, assuming that the pattern of the first few terms continues. (assume that
Lilit [14]
Your sequence
  -8, 16/3, -32/9, 64/27
is a geometric sequence with first term -8 and common ratio
  (16/3)/(-8) = (-32/9)/(16/3) = -2/3

The general term an of a geometric sequence with first term a1 and ratio r is given by
  an = a1·r^(n-1)
For your sequence, this is
  an = -8·(-2/3)^(n-1)
